Thule 460R Rapid Podium roof rack

Using the Thule 3069 Podium Fit Kit, along with the Thule 460R Rapid Podium Foot Pack and pair of Thule Rapid Aero load bars, to install the Thule 460R Rapid Podium car rack system to a 2006 Mazda 3 5-door hatchback, this video delivers a good demonstration and explanation on how to mount a roofrack to a car, van or pickup truck cab roof that has factory installed fixed attachment points. Many modern vehicles have fixed point attachments located on the roof top. These points allow for the installation of an aftermarket multi-purpose base rack system. The Thule Racks 460R Rapid Podium system delivers a superb, clean and premium integrated look when installed. There are many different styles and types of fixed point attachments on the various vehicle makes and models, hence Thule Racks offers many different Podium Fit Kits to fit these specific configurations (the video uses the 3069 Fit Kit on the Mazda 3 as an example).

Yakima Control Towers roof rack system

An excellent demonstration video featuring one of the several applications the Yakima Control Tower roof rack system is designed for, in this case used as a complete multi-purpose base rack system for a car with factory installed fixed point attachments located on the vehicle roof top. Video shows how the Yakima Racks LP11 Landing Pads #11  mount to the 2000 Mazda 3 5-door hatchback fixed attachment points. The set of 4 Yakima Control Towers (with the pair of cross bars connected) then quickly attach to the Landing Pads. There are several Yakima Landing Pads available for use with specific vehicles with factory fixed point rack attachment locations. As stated previously, the Yakima Control Towers and Landing Pads are a very versatile solution for multiple types of other applications including mounting to factory tracks (replacing the factory rack), permanently installed roof tracks on cars, pickup truck caps, toppers & camper shells, roof tracks on popup campers etc.

2000 Honda Civic 2 Door Bike Rack

by Rack James on June 21, 2010

2000 Honda Civic car rack bike racks with Yakima Q Towers, Q69 and Q70 Q Clips, Yakima 48 inch Cross Bars, Yakima Q Stretch Kit, wind fairing, HighRoller upright style bike rack and Yakima Steelhead fork mounted bike carrier.

Customer install photo of a roof bike rack for 2000 Honda Civic 2 Door using the Yakima Q Tower car rack system (includes Yakima Q Towers, Yakima Q69 and Q70 Q Clips, Yakima 48" Cross Bars) with the Yakima Q Stretch Kit and Yakima 44" Large Fairing. Bike Trays are the Yakima HighRoller upright style bike rack and the Yakima Steelhead fork mounted bike tray.

2 door vehicles with naked roofs, like this 2000 Honda Civic, often require the use of a stretch kit to increase the cross bar spread to at least a minimum of 24″ which is just enough to safely carry most gear (canoes excluded).  This 2000 Honda Civic 2-door bike rack system is using the Yakima Q-Tower roof rack system (includes Yakima Q-Towers, Yakima Q69 Q clips and Yakima Q70 Q Clips, and Yakima 48″ Cross Bars) with the Yakima Q-Stretch kit and can easily transport two bicycles.  One bike carrier is the Yakima HighRoller bike rack, which doesn’t require the removal of the front wheel.  The other bike tray is the Yakima SteelHead bike rack, a fork mounted bike tray, which does require the removal of the front wheel.  To keep things nice and quiet up there, we have the Yakima 44″ Large Fairing-Wind Deflector.  A Yakima SKS 6 pack of locks keeps everything nice and secure from theft.

Thule 45050 Crossroad car rack kit

Thule 45058 Crossroad car rack kit

ORS Racks Direct offers another demonstration video, this time featuring the Thule Racks 45050 Crossroad / 45058 Crossroad roof rack kits. Video delivers a good explanation of these multi-purpose base rack systems for use on vehicles with factory side rails and how they are exactly the same as the regular Thule 450 Crossroad car rack system, except that these kits also include a set of Thule locks & keys and a specific length pair of load bars (the regular Thule 450 allows you to choose various cross bars length options). So if you know you want to use the 50 inch load bars, a better value deal is to go with the Thule 45050 kit (and likewise go with the Thule 45058 kit if you want to use 58 inch length crossbars).  With the regular 450 Crossroad system you will need to purchase locks separately and the total will cost more than going with the all inclusive kit options.

2010 Subaru Forester Kayak Roof Rack

by Rack James on June 15, 2010

2010 Subaru Forester kayak roof rack Thule 450 Crossroad feet 50 inch Crossbars Malone SeaWing kayak saddles

Side view of a 2010 Subaru Forester hauling two kayaks using the Thule 450 Crossroads feet with a pair of Thule 50" Crossbars and two set of the Malone SeaWing kayak saddles tied down with included load straps and tie downs.

 Do you have two 14′ kayaks and a 250 mile drive to the water?  This rack master does.  Using the Thule 450 Crossroad roof rack system  (includes Thule 450 Crossroads foot pack and pair of 50″ Load bars) for use with factory side rails, this 2010 Subaru Forester roof rack kayak carrier set up can easily carry two large boats side by side with room to spare.  The kayak saddles chosen for this adventure are the Malone SeaWing kayak saddles which use universal mounting hardware to attach to Thule loadbars (as shown here), Inno, and Yakima crossbars as well as virtually all factory crossbars.  These boats aren’t going to budge during the trip thanks to well done strapping down with the included load straps and bow/stern tie downs.  For easier loading and unloading of the kayaks, the Malone Seawing kayak carrier can be combined with the Malone Stinger Lift Assist, which uses a sliding V-shaped cradle that extends backwards from the SeaWing saddle, providing a lower and further back loading point that will guide the boat forward into the saddles as you are lifting and pushing.

Malone Universal Cross Bars roof rack

If you’ve tightened the belt on spending these days and are frantically searching for a roof rack system that attaches to vehicle factory raised side rails, providing the cross bars needed for mounting gear carriers to carry your gear like surfboards, stand up paddleboard SUP, bikes, kayaks, canoe, skis and snowboards, luggage etc., you won’t want to waste any time checking out this new ORS Racks Direct video that showcases the Malone Auto Racks Universal Cross Rail roof rack system. The video covers all the features of this product, as well as providing a demonstration of how to install it onto a vehicle with factory raised side rails (the model vehicle in the video is a 2008 Volvo XC90). Mounts to most any standard raised factory side rails, however will not work on super fat diameter side rails such as those found on Nissan XTerra etc. This roof rack is available at a fraction of the cost of other much more expensive options from other leading car rack manufacturers (and the Malone Universal Cross Rails roof rack even includes a set of locks & keys to lock the car rack to the vehicle). FYI, for those that do not know, side rails are the pair of factory bars that run from the front to back of the roof top on the drivers side and passengers side.

Yakima Q Towers roof rack

If your car or pickup truck cab has nothing on the roof top currently, such as no factory rack or factory side rails, no raingutters / drip rails, no roof tracks, no fixed attachment points etc., most likely your vehicle will require the Yakima Q Towers roof rack system. This multi-purpose base rack system provides the foundation that will then allow for the attachment of any roof mount gear carrriers for transporting, ski & snowboards, bikes, kayaks, canoe, surfboards, stand up paddle boards, luggage and more. Included with the Yakima Q Towers roof rack system are a set of four Yakima Q Towers, two pairs of Yakima Q Clips and a pair of Yakima round cross bars. You will attach the gear carriers to the Q Tower cross bars. This Yakima Q Towers video from ORS Racks Direct explains and demonstrates the features of this system, how to install the Yakima Q Towers and more. Very quick to install with easy-to-follow instructions included, the Q Towers are the leading roof rack base system for vehicles with nothing on the roof top currently. Accessory options such as a 4-pack of Yakima locks & keys (to lock the roof rack to the vehicle) and wind fairing (for design styling and elimination of any possible rack noise or ‘whistling’) are highly recommended.

Yakima Q Towers Half Pack roof rack

This ORS Racks Direct demonstration video highlights the Yakima Q Tower Half Pack roof rack system, a single cross bar roof rack set up that is most often used in combination with a trailer hitch mount T-bar style hitch rack for hauling very long gear and equipment such as rowing sculls, canoes, lumber, ladders etc. The Yakima Q Towers Half Pack video shows the Yakima Q Towers Half Pack system used in combination with the Yakima DryDock T-bar hitch rack. It is also commonly used on the cab roof of a pickup truck to help stabilize very long items hauled on a pickup truck bed truck rack system.

2009 Hyundai Santa Fe car rack rowing shell carrier for carrying a rowing scull using the Thule 460 Podium roof rack (includes Thule 3024 Fit Kit) with the Thule 997 GoalPost.

Customer install photo of a 2009 Hyundai Santa Fe roof rack rowing shell rack system for transporting a rowing scull to and from the water. It is configured using the Thule 460 Podium roof rack system (includes Thule 460 Podium Foot pack, Thule 3024 Fit Kit, and Thule Load Bars) with the Thule 997 GoalPost hitch mounted rack with 58" Load Bar.

You don’t want to mess around when you’re transporting a fine rowing scull, so this 2009 Hyundai Santa Fe roof rack rowing shell carrier uses three crossbars for optimum support.  On the roof is the Thule 460 Podium roof rack system which mounts to the factory fixed mounting points found on the 2009 Hyundai Santa Fe roof top.  The Thule 460 Podium car rack system uses a set of Thule 460 Podium feet, the Thule 3024 Fit Kit, and a pair of Thule 50″ Load bars and is locked down with the Thule 544 lock pack.  For additional stability for longer loads such as a rowing scull, canoe, or kayak, the Thule 997 GoalPost hitch rack is added, which mounts into a 2″ trailer hitch receiver and supports a 58″ Load Bar.  The Thule 997 Goalpost hitch rack can be adjusted up or down so that the load bar can be leveled with the load bars on the roof.  For added security, the Thule STL 2 Snug-Tite Lock is incorporated, which locks the Thule 997 Goalpost into the reciever. 

The only suggestion we might make is instead of using foam noodles to support the rowing shell on the load bars, we would use a set of kayak saddles, such as the 878XT Set-t0-Go kayak saddles, which would do an even better job of ensuring that this fine rowing scull gets to the water without a scratch.

Thule 480 Traverse roof rack system

The Thule 480 Traverse roof rack video from ORS Racks Direct offers an excellent demonstration of this multi-purpose base rack system that fits virtually all cars, vans and pickup trucks that currently have nothing on the roof top (no factory rack or factory side rails, no raingutters, no roof tracks, fix-point attachments etc.) The result of years of extensive design and engineering, the Thule 480 Traverse system is a vast improvement over the previous Thule 400XT Aero roofrack system. Uses half the parts of the 400XT Aero and installs in a fraction of the time. Includes Thule 480 Traverse Foot Pack, Traverse Fit Kit clips (many Fit Kits available, each designed to custom fit specific vehicles) and pair of load bars (varying load bar lengths available). Features sleek, aerodydnamic and modern styling that delivers a slick integrated look on all styles of vehicles. Any Thule gear carriers (as well as gear carriers from other car rack makers) will mount directly to the Thule square load bars.
